Innovations in Drainage Technology for Dust Control in Barns
Effective dust control in barns is essential for maintaining animal health and ensuring a safe environment for workers. Recent innovations in drainage technology have significantly improved dust management in agricultural settings. By integrating advanced systems, farmers can reduce airborne particles, enhance air quality, and promote better living conditions for livestock.
What Are the Latest Innovations in Drainage Technology for Dust Control?
Recent advancements in drainage technology focus on improving airflow, moisture management, and dust suppression. These innovations include:
-
Permeable Flooring Systems: These systems allow liquids to pass through, minimizing dust accumulation by keeping surfaces dry. They are designed to improve drainage efficiency and reduce the need for frequent cleaning.
-
Automated Sprinkler Systems: These systems periodically dampen surfaces, preventing dust from becoming airborne. They can be programmed to operate at specific intervals, ensuring consistent dust control.
-
Sloped Flooring Designs: Sloped floors facilitate the quick removal of waste and moisture, reducing the conditions that contribute to dust formation. This design improves overall barn hygiene and air quality.
How Do Permeable Flooring Systems Work?
Permeable flooring systems are designed to enhance drainage by allowing liquids to pass through their surface. These systems typically consist of porous materials that effectively separate solid waste from liquids. As a result, they help maintain a drier environment, which is crucial for minimizing dust.
Benefits of Permeable Flooring
- Improved Hygiene: By allowing liquids to drain quickly, these systems reduce the buildup of waste and bacteria.
- Reduced Cleaning Time: Less frequent cleaning is required, saving time and labor costs.
- Enhanced Air Quality: By minimizing moisture, permeable floors help reduce the conditions that lead to dust formation.
What Role Do Automated Sprinkler Systems Play?
Automated sprinkler systems are another innovation in barn dust control. These systems work by periodically spraying water or other dust-suppressing solutions onto barn surfaces. This process helps keep dust particles from becoming airborne, thereby improving air quality.
Advantages of Automated Sprinkler Systems
- Consistent Dust Control: Regular spraying ensures that dust is continuously managed.
- Customizable Settings: Farmers can adjust the frequency and duration of spraying to suit specific needs.
- Energy Efficiency: Modern systems are designed to use minimal water and energy, reducing operational costs.
Why Are Sloped Flooring Designs Effective?
Sloped flooring designs are engineered to facilitate efficient drainage by directing liquids toward designated drainage areas. This design helps in quickly removing waste and moisture, thereby reducing the potential for dust formation.
Key Benefits of Sloped Flooring
- Enhanced Waste Management: Liquids and waste are directed away from animal living areas, improving hygiene.
- Reduced Dust: By minimizing moisture, sloped floors help prevent dust from accumulating.
- Improved Airflow: Better drainage promotes airflow, enhancing overall barn ventilation.

How Does Dust Control Impact Animal Health?
Dust control is crucial for animal health as excessive dust can lead to respiratory issues and other health problems. By reducing dust levels, barns can provide a healthier environment for livestock, leading to improved productivity and well-being.
What Are the Cost Implications of Implementing New Drainage Systems?
The cost of implementing new drainage systems can vary based on the size of the barn and the specific technology used. However, the long-term benefits, such as reduced cleaning costs and improved animal health, often outweigh the initial investment.
Can These Systems Be Retrofitted into Existing Barns?
Yes, many modern drainage and dust control systems can be retrofitted into existing barns. This flexibility allows farmers to upgrade their facilities without the need for complete reconstruction.
What Maintenance is Required for These Systems?
Regular maintenance is necessary to ensure optimal performance. This includes routine checks, cleaning of components, and occasional system adjustments to maintain efficiency.
